In an increasingly secular world, how can a Christian be against the only pop culture voice that acknowledges the potential existence of demons and angels and debates the role of the human soul?
Lazy Christians find Satan in art, and ban it. Thinking Christians find God in art, and use it.
As G.K. Chesterton (the Christian who was key in converting C.S. Lewis to Christianity) said:
“Fairy tales are more than true; not because they tell us that dragons exist, but because they tell us that dragons can be beaten.”
